In the 'Author's Introduction and Acknowledgements' to the 1998 reprint of his book "Titanic Voyager: The Odyssey of C.H. Lightoller," British author Patrick Stenson thanks the following relatives: Anne-Marie Oblensky and Tim Lightoller, cousins, and grandchildren; and Betty Lightoller.
